Housing tenure
About this topic
Housing tenure shows whether households own their dwelling outright, are purchasing it, rent privately, rent from a social landlord, or occupy it under another arrangement. It describes how households hold or access housing, not the type of dwelling itself.
This topic is useful for analysing housing markets, affordability, stability, and the mix of owners and renters. It works best alongside dwelling type, household composition, and housing cost topics such as mortgage repayments and rent.
Interpretation notes
- Tenure type describes how the dwelling is occupied, including ownership, mortgage, rental, or other arrangements.
- It applies to occupied private dwellings and should not be confused with dwelling structure or housing cost measures.
Key insight
In 2021, 73.9% of households in Mansfield (S) were purchasing or had fully paid off their home, while 15% were renting. The mortgage share was lower than Regional Vic. (31.5%).

Data table
Housing tenure for Mansfield (S). Housing tenure. 2021 and 2016 counts, percentages, and change compared with Regional Vic..
| Category | 2021 | 2016 | Change | |||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Count | % | Regional Vic.% | Count | % | Regional Vic.% | Count | pp | |
| Fully owned | 1,905 | 44.6% | 37.6% | 1,477 | 41.8% | 35.7% | +428 | +2.8pp |
| Mortgage | 1,252 | 29.3% | 31.5% | 1,011 | 28.6% | 31.2% | +241 | +0.7pp |
| Renting - Total | 640 | 15.0% | 22.6% | 651 | 18.4% | 23.9% | -11 | -3.4pp |
| Renting - Social housing | 58 | 1.4% | 3.0% | 54 | 1.5% | 3.3% | +4 | -0.1pp |
| Renting - Private | 578 | 13.5% | 19.5% | 552 | 15.6% | 19.8% | +26 | -2.1pp |
| Renting - Not stated | 4 | 0.1% | 0.2% | 42 | 1.2% | 0.7% | -38 | -1.1pp |
| Other tenure type | 145 | 3.4% | 2.0% | 58 | 1.6% | 0.8% | +87 | +1.8pp |
| Not stated | 335 | 7.8% | 6.4% | 350 | 9.9% | 8.4% | -15 | -2.1pp |
| Total households | 4,276 | 100.0% | 100.0% | 3,537 | 100.0% | 100.0% | +739 | 0.0pp |
